Mailgun features and specs

  • Scalability
    Mailgun can handle high volumes of emails efficiently, making it ideal for businesses of all sizes, from startups to large enterprises.
  • API Flexibility
    Mailgun offers a robust and flexible API that is developer-friendly, allowing for easy integration and customization to fit specific needs.
  • Deliverability
    Mailgun has strong email deliverability rates due to its reputation and infrastructure, which helps ensure emails reach recipients' inboxes as intended.
  • Analytics and Tracking
    It provides comprehensive email analytics and tracking features, allowing businesses to monitor open rates, click-through rates, and other vital statistics.
  • SMTP Relay
    Mailgun supports SMTP Relay, making it versatile for sending emails from a variety of applications and systems.
  • Support and Documentation
    Mailgun offers extensive support and documentation, which helps in troubleshooting and enhances the user experience.

Possible disadvantages of Mailgun

  • Cost
    Mailgun pricing can become expensive for high-volume email senders, especially when compared to some other email service providers.
  • Complex Setup
    Initial setup and configuration of Mailgun can be complex, particularly for users who are not very technical.
  • Spam and Bounce Management
    While deliverability is generally strong, some users have reported challenges with spam and bounce management, which can affect email performance metrics.
  • Learning Curve
    For those new to email APIs or less tech-savvy, there might be a steep learning curve to effectively use all of Mailgun's features.
  • Customer Support Response Time
    Some users have reported slower response times from customer support, which can be a drawback if immediate assistance is needed.

Transactional email providers for indie businesses 2020
Mailgunโ€™s one dedicated IP address starts with the Foundation plan ($35) for 100k emails and up ($75). You might consider going for the growth plan ($80) already with 1000 email address validations included.

8 Most Reliable Mandrill Alternative SMTP Relays
Mailgun can push a webhook to the userโ€™s app ( like EasySendy Pro), whenever an action takes place on the sent emails. The MailGun API offers much more than just sending the emails. Users can send up to a thousand personalized email messages with a single API call, making it effortless to send out bulk mailings from an app. Moreover, users can use tags to segregate their...
Source: easysendy.com
7 Best Transactional Email Services: Sendgrid vs. Mandrill & More
Hi, I use Mailgun for sending transactional mails and send around 2k mails per week and we are on shared IP and so, I am facing some issues like ESP throttling issues, because of the others who are using the same as I do. I have to get my shared IP changed every time I ran into these kind of issues. Mailgun recommends to use a dedicated IP when you send more than 5k mails...

  • The 7 best transactional email services for developers in 2023
    Mailgun from Sinch is a well-established, developer-focused email service that's been in business since 2010. It powers email delivery for some large, well-known companies including Lyft, American Express, and Wikipedia. As a developer-focused tool, Mailgun is fast to get started with and integrate into your product. It's an excellent offering if you're looking for a reliable, easy-to-use product. - Source: dev.to / almost 2 years ago
